/art/libelffile/elf/ |
D | elf_debug_reader.h | 49 size_t size() const { return sizeof(uint32_t) + length; } in size() function 135 DCHECK_LE(entry->size(), debug_frame->sh_size - offset); in VisitDebugFrame() 142 offset += entry->size(); in VisitDebugFrame() 153 DCHECK_LE(offset + sizeof(T), file_.size()); in Read() 159 DCHECK_LE(offset + count * sizeof(T), file_.size()); in Read()
|
/art/libelffile/dwarf/ |
D | debug_info_entry_writer.h | 62 abbrev_code_offset_ = this->data()->size(); in StartTag() 87 patch_locations_.push_back(this->data()->size()); in WriteAddr() 103 this->PushUleb128(dchecked_integral_cast<uint32_t>(expr.size())); in WriteExprLoc() 179 this->PushUint32(debug_str->size()); in WriteStrp() 197 using Writer<Vector>::size;
|
/art/libartbase/base/ |
D | arena_allocator.cc | 176 void ArenaAllocatorMemoryTool::DoMakeDefined(void* ptr, size_t size) { in DoMakeDefined() argument 177 MEMORY_TOOL_MAKE_DEFINED(ptr, size); in DoMakeDefined() 180 void ArenaAllocatorMemoryTool::DoMakeUndefined(void* ptr, size_t size) { in DoMakeUndefined() argument 181 MEMORY_TOOL_MAKE_UNDEFINED(ptr, size); in DoMakeUndefined() 184 void ArenaAllocatorMemoryTool::DoMakeInaccessible(void* ptr, size_t size) { in DoMakeInaccessible() argument 185 MEMORY_TOOL_MAKE_NOACCESS(ptr, size); in DoMakeInaccessible()
|
D | transform_array_ref.h | 106 size_type size() const { return base().size(); } in size() function 165 return lhs.size() == rhs.size() && std::equal(lhs.begin(), lhs.end(), rhs.begin()); 184 ArrayRef<typename Container::value_type>(container.data(), container.size()), f); in MakeTransformArrayRef() 191 ArrayRef<const typename Container::value_type>(container.data(), container.size()), f); in MakeTransformArrayRef()
|
D | transform_iterator_test.cc | 99 for (size_t i = 0; i != input.size(); ++i) { in TEST() 102 ptrdiff_t index_from_rbegin = static_cast<ptrdiff_t>(input.size() - i - 1u); in TEST() 105 ptrdiff_t index_from_end = -static_cast<ptrdiff_t>(input.size() - i); in TEST() 130 (MakeTransformIterator(input.begin(), add1) + input.size()).base()); in TEST() 132 static_cast<ptrdiff_t>(input.size())); in TEST() 304 for (size_t i = 0; i != input.size(); ++i) { in TEST() 307 ptrdiff_t index_from_rbegin = static_cast<ptrdiff_t>(input.size() - i - 1u); in TEST() 310 ptrdiff_t index_from_end = -static_cast<ptrdiff_t>(input.size() - i); in TEST() 335 (MakeTransformIterator(input.begin(), ref) + input.size()).base()); in TEST() 337 static_cast<ptrdiff_t>(input.size())); in TEST() [all …]
|
D | arena_bit_vector.cc | 65 void* Alloc(size_t size) override { in Alloc() argument 66 return allocator_->Alloc(size, this->Kind()); in Alloc()
|
D | mem_map.cc | 153 bool MemMap::ContainedWithinExistingMap(uint8_t* ptr, size_t size, std::string* error_msg) { in ContainedWithinExistingMap() argument 155 uintptr_t end = begin + size; in ContainedWithinExistingMap() 277 void MemMap::SetDebugName(void* map_ptr, const char* name, size_t size) { in SetDebugName() argument 297 prctl(PR_SET_VMA, PR_SET_VMA_ANON_NAME, map_ptr, size, it->first.c_str()); in SetDebugName() 300 UNUSED(map_ptr, size); in SetDebugName() 680 MemMap::MemMap(const std::string& name, uint8_t* begin, size_t size, void* base_begin, in MemMap() argument 682 : name_(name), begin_(begin), size_(size), base_begin_(base_begin), base_size_(base_size), in MemMap() 926 size_t size = map->BaseSize(); in DumpMapsLocked() local 927 CHECK_ALIGNED(size, kPageSize); in DumpMapsLocked() 935 os << "+0x" << std::hex << (size / kPageSize) << "P"; in DumpMapsLocked() [all …]
|
/art/tools/ahat/src/test/com/android/ahat/ |
D | ObjectsHandlerTest.java | 40 assertEquals(1, dumped.size()); in getObjects() 51 assertEquals(1, subclass.size()); in getObjects()
|
/art/compiler/driver/ |
D | compiled_method_storage_test.cc | 77 CHECK_EQ(compiled_methods.size(), 1u << 4); in TEST() 78 for (size_t i = 0; i != compiled_methods.size(); ++i) { in TEST() 79 for (size_t j = 0; j != compiled_methods.size(); ++j) { in TEST()
|
D | dex_compilation_unit.cc | 70 for (size_t i = 0, size = compiling_class->NumInstanceFields(); i != size; ++i) { in RequiresConstructorBarrier() local
|
/art/tools/jvmti-agents/field-counts/ |
D | fieldcount.cc | 56 env->NewGlobalRef(env->FindClass(class_name.substr(1, class_name.size() - 2).c_str()))); in SplitField() 141 jlong size = 0; in DataDumpRequestCb() local 146 CHECK_JVMTI(jvmti->GetObjectSize(obj.get(), &size)); in DataDumpRequestCb() 163 jlong size = 0; in DataDumpRequestCb() local 168 CHECK_JVMTI(jvmti->GetObjectSize(obj.get(), &size)); in DataDumpRequestCb() 172 total_size += static_cast<size_t>(size); in DataDumpRequestCb() 173 class_sizes[class_name] += static_cast<size_t>(size); in DataDumpRequestCb()
|
/art/cmdline/ |
D | token_range.h | 310 new_token_list.push_back(string.substr(next_token_idx, tok.size())); in MatchSubstrings() 312 string_idx += tok.size(); in MatchSubstrings() 315 size_t remaining = string.size() - string_idx; in MatchSubstrings() 385 if (larger.size() >= smaller.size()) { in StartsWith() 413 assert(token_list_->size() > token_list->size() && "Nothing was actually removed!"); in RemoveIf()
|
/art/tools/ahat/src/main/com/android/ahat/heapdump/ |
D | AhatInstance.java | 141 Size size = Size.ZERO; in getTotalRetainedSize() local 144 size = size.plus(mRetainedSizes[i]); in getTotalRetainedSize() 147 return size; in getTotalRetainedSize() 153 void addRegisteredNativeSize(long size) { in addRegisteredNativeSize() argument 154 mRegisteredNativeSize += size; in addRegisteredNativeSize() 600 public long size; field in AhatInstance.RegisteredNativeAllocation
|
/art/compiler/optimizing/ |
D | scheduler_arm64.cc | 321 size_t size ATTRIBUTE_UNUSED) { in HandleVecAddress() 330 size_t size = DataType::Size(instr->GetPackedType()); in VisitVecLoad() local 337 HandleVecAddress(instr, size); in VisitVecLoad() 340 HandleVecAddress(instr, size); in VisitVecLoad() 347 size_t size = DataType::Size(instr->GetPackedType()); in VisitVecStore() local 348 HandleVecAddress(instr, size); in VisitVecStore()
|
/art/compiler/debug/ |
D | elf_debug_info_writer.h | 126 info_.WriteSecOffset(DW_AT_ranges, owner_->debug_ranges_.size()); in Write() 165 size_t type_attrib_offset = info_.size(); in Write() 223 if (i < param_names.size()) { in Write() 279 buffer.reserve(info_.data()->size() + KB); in Write() 283 owner_->builder_->GetDebugInfo()->WriteFully(buffer.data(), buffer.size()); in Write() 373 base_class_references.emplace(info_.size(), base_class.Ptr()); in Write() 443 buffer.reserve(info_.data()->size() + KB); in Write() 447 owner_->builder_->GetDebugInfo()->WriteFully(buffer.data(), buffer.size()); in Write() 496 lazy_types_.emplace(std::string(type_descriptor), info_.size()); in WriteLazyType() 549 DCHECK_EQ(desc.size(), 1u); in WriteTypeDeclaration() [all …]
|
/art/runtime/base/ |
D | timing_logger_test.cc | 33 EXPECT_EQ(2U, timings.size()); // Start, End splits in TEST_F() 52 EXPECT_EQ(6U, timings.size()); in TEST_F() 80 EXPECT_EQ(10U, timings.size()); in TEST_F() 125 EXPECT_EQ(8U, timings.size()); // 4 start timings and 4 end timings. in TEST_F() 155 EXPECT_EQ(8U, timings.size()); in TEST_F()
|
/art/runtime/ |
D | module_exclusion_test.cc | 65 for (size_t i = 0u, size = dex_file->NumClassDefs(); i != size; ++i) { in DoTest() local 87 CHECK_EQ(filename.size(), 1u); in GetModuleFileName() 98 CHECK_NE(0U, dex_files.size()); in LoadModule() 153 ASSERT_TRUE(package_list_file.GetFile()->WriteFully(data.data(), data.size())); in TEST_F()
|
D | debugger.cc | 190 ScopedLocalRef<jbyteArray> dataArray(env, env->NewByteArray(data.size())); in DdmHandleChunk() 192 LOG(WARNING) << "byte[] allocation failed: " << data.size(); in DdmHandleChunk() 198 data.size(), in DdmHandleChunk() 206 type, dataArray.get(), 0, data.size())); in DdmHandleChunk() 331 CHECK_EQ(bytes.size(), char_count*2 + sizeof(uint32_t)*2); in DdmSendThreadNotification() 442 CHECK_EQ(bytes.size(), 4U + (heap_count * (4 + 8 + 1 + 4 + 4 + 4 + 4))); in DdmSendHeapInfo() 731 const size_t size = RoundUp(obj->SizeOf(), kObjectAlignment); in DdmSendHeapSegments() local 733 obj, reinterpret_cast<void*>(reinterpret_cast<uintptr_t>(obj) + size), size, &context); in DdmSendHeapSegments() 869 return table_.size(); in Size() 1029 size_t string_table_offset = bytes.size(); in GetRecentAllocations() [all …]
|
/art/cmdline/detail/ |
D | cmdline_parse_argument_detail.h | 194 assert(names_.size() >= 1); in CompleteArgument() 254 token_count == names_.size())); in CompleteArgument() 259 blank_count == names_.size())); in CompleteArgument() 280 assert(names_.size() == value_list_.size() in CompleteArgument() 286 assert(names_.size() == value_map_.size() && in CompleteArgument() 484 assert(arg_def_idx + 1 == argument_info_.value_list_.size() && in ParseArgumentSingle()
|
/art/compiler/utils/ |
D | assembler_test.h | 223 if (str.size() > 0) { 285 if (str.size() > 0) { in RepeatTemplatedRegistersImmBits() 308 WarnOnCombinations(reg1_registers.size() * reg2_registers.size() * imms.size()); in RepeatTemplatedImmBitsRegisters() 340 if (str.size() > 0) { in RepeatTemplatedImmBitsRegisters() 384 if (str.size() > 0) { in RepeatTemplatedRegisterImmBits() 565 WarnOnCombinations(imms.size()); 582 if (str.size() > 0) { 1087 WarnOnCombinations(addresses.size()); in RepeatTemplatedMem() 1101 if (str.size() > 0) { in RepeatTemplatedMem() 1118 WarnOnCombinations(addresses.size() * imms.size()); in RepeatTemplatedMemImm() [all …]
|
D | assembler.h | 123 void Move(size_t newposition, size_t oldposition, size_t size) { in Move() argument 125 DCHECK_LE(oldposition + size, Size()); in Move() 126 DCHECK_LE(newposition + size, Size()); in Move() 127 memmove(contents_ + newposition, contents_ + oldposition, size); in Move() 324 return delayed_advance_pcs_.size(); in NumberOfDelayedAdvancePCs() 347 DCHECK_LE(last, raw_data.size()); in AppendRawData()
|
/art/runtime/mirror/ |
D | method_type_test.cc | 43 CHECK_LT(param_types.size(), 3u); in CreateMethodType() 61 mirror::ObjectArray<mirror::Class>::Alloc(self, class_array_type, param_types.size())); in CreateMethodType() 63 for (uint32_t i = 0; i < param_types.size(); ++i) { in CreateMethodType()
|
/art/compiler/jni/ |
D | jni_cfi_test.cc | 90 size_t size = mr_conv->IsCurrentParamALongOrDouble() ? 8u : 4u; in TestImplSized() local 91 jni_asm->Store(mr_conv->CurrentParamStackOffset(), mr_conv->CurrentParamRegister(), size); in TestImplSized() 99 MemoryRegion code(&actual_asm[0], actual_asm.size()); in TestImplSized()
|
/art/dexdump/ |
D | dexdump_cfg.cc | 84 uint32_t id = dex_pc_to_node_id.size(); in DumpMethodCFG() 97 dex_pc_to_incl_id.insert(std::make_pair(dex_pc, dex_pc_to_node_id.size() - 1)); in DumpMethodCFG() 115 os << inst_str.substr(cur_start, inst_str.size() - cur_start); in DumpMethodCFG() 120 while (next_escape < inst_str.size()) { in DumpMethodCFG() 129 if (next_escape >= inst_str.size()) { in DumpMethodCFG() 141 if (dex_pc_to_node_id.size() > 0) { in DumpMethodCFG()
|
/art/test/1940-ddms-ext/ |
D | ddm_ext.cc | 41 DdmCallbackData(jint type, jint size, jbyte* data) : type_(type), data_(data, data + size) {} in DdmCallbackData() 151 ScopedLocalRef<jbyteArray> res(env, env->NewByteArray(cb.data_.size())); in Java_art_Test1940_publishListen() 152 env->SetByteArrayRegion(res.get(), 0, cb.data_.size(), cb.data_.data()); in Java_art_Test1940_publishListen() 159 static void JNICALL PublishCB(jvmtiEnv* jvmti, jint type, jint size, jbyte* bytes) { in PublishCB() argument 163 data->callbacks_received.emplace(type, size, bytes); in PublishCB()
|